So we're going to drop that Edmund interview in just a little bit, but before we do, some news broke in the last three days, some very big news. A former Wimbledon champion has been banned for four years for missing a drug test. That's Marketa Vondrousova. Obviously, everyone remembers her Wimbledon triumph. That was absolutely amazing. She has been banned for years for missing a drug test. A lot of people out there don't really know how the drug, as the testing, the whereabouts system works. I'm going to try to sum it up just super quickly. You have one hour that you have to make yourself available at all times, 365 days a year. Typically for us, for me, it was 6 to 7 a.m. I don't know about you guys, Stevie, Sam.

**Stevie Johnson** (2:51)
Yeah, 5 to 6 a.m. for me.

**Sam Querrey** (2:53)
Most players, I think, is between that 5 to 8 a.m. window.

**John Isner** (2:57)
Exactly. Because you know your home, you know you're sleeping. It's unpleasant to get woken up for a urine and blood test, but that's what it is. It's how you keep your sport clean, so be it. And they came to her house or her apartment outside of her window. We don't know what her designated window was, but according to Marketa, they came outside her window and she refused the drug test.
And because of that, she has been banned for years.

**Sam Querrey** (3:23)
Can I just add real quick, you are allowed to come outside the window, and if you're not home at that time, that's what I was going to start with. You're going to get a missed test.

**John Isner** (3:30)
Yeah.

**Stevie Johnson** (3:30)
Okay. Yeah.

**John Isner** (3:31)
So I was going to let Stevie explain that a little bit. The drug testers can come outside of your window, and if you're not home, which you're not supposed to, because that's not your hour, you don't get, nothing happens, you don't get penalized in any ways. So go ahead, Stevie.

**Stevie Johnson** (3:45)
So you get, let's call it a 12-month rolling period. January 1, I mean, it could be any time, but you have to do that every single day, as John mentioned. If you miss a test, that's one strike, you miss a second test, second, you get three strikes in that rolling year to then you're suspended. If you miss three of those at-home tests, that basically just incurs a suspension right away. We've seen players have that happen in the past, pretty recently, actually, if I'm not mistaken.
